1. ASML’s Fourth-Quarter 2025 Earnings Preview

ASML is set to release its fourth-quarter 2025 results on January 28 before market open. Analysts forecast a 15% year-over-year increase in net sales, driven by continued ramp-up of extreme ultraviolet (EUV) lithography system shipments and accelerating demand from leading semiconductor foundries. The company’s backlog of EUV tools remains near record levels, supporting visibility into 2026 deliveries. Investors will scrutinize gross margin trends, where consensus estimates call for a slight sequential improvement to approximately 53%, reflecting stronger absorption of fixed costs and higher utilization of service offerings. Management commentary on end-customer capex plans, particularly for AI chip production, will be key for assessing the sustainability of order momentum.

2. Valuation and Growth Outlook

Despite strong demand, ASML’s valuation stands at roughly 34 times forward earnings, above its long-term average multiple. This premium reflects its technology exclusivity in EUV lithography and a market capitalization exceeding $500 billion. Wall Street consensus projects 15% revenue growth for the next fiscal year, compared with 31% at Taiwan Semiconductor and 51% at Nvidia, highlighting a relative growth premium already priced in. Dividend investors can note the company’s modest yield of around 0.5%, underlining its focus on reinvestment into R&D and capacity expansion. For long-term holders, the key consideration is whether ASML’s leadership in next-generation multi-pattern EUV and high-NA development justifies a top-quartile valuation versus alternative chip-equipment plays.
